Output 10909072c182176b3ff9509780ca7edeaad2bd1ce0940d73183d762f5799c596:0

value
20566073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b38abaae85246094c3399f249b2d88bcad0c0f OP_EQUAL
address
3KtwUWTTzqK92trSDGsreEsnHvSdDqpzVW
transaction
10909072c182176b3ff9509780ca7edeaad2bd1ce0940d73183d762f5799c596
confirmations
174582
spent
true